Return on Investment
A performance measure used to evaluate the efficiency or profitability of an investment or compare the efficiency of a number of different investments.
Total Liabilities
The sum of all debts and financial obligations a company owes to outside parties.
Total Assets
The sum of all resources owned by a company or an individual, valued in monetary terms, which includes tangible and intangible items.
